Whadja use for that netting in the back?minor update, Have been working on a few low budget mods. Fabbed up a quick set of wheelwell/bulkheads for the front and rear wheels to keep the rocks out of the interior. Just cut up some mockups on stiff paper and then transfered to some 1/16'" lexan. Front bols on with stock skin and rear is ziptied in. Also did a bit of camaflage for the rear deck. I have no intentions of adding any weight up high or adding scale stuff so I just want it to look clean and simple. For now the mesh works.
Also trying out a new hood, not sure what I think. I have another donor body I am going to try to see if I like it better. Any opinions welcome.....thumbs up or down?

Please help. Just testing my new electronics setup and I need some help. I have a Tekin 17.5 wired up to a Mamba Max Pro on a 2c 5200 2500. The radio is the stock Axial Wraith unit.
My problem is that forward and reverse are backwards on the radio, but when I switch the radio to reverse the action, it works but the forward is only 30% of full throttle when pinned, and reverse runs full blast. I have tried the programming card and cannot find a setting to correct this. I double checked my wires and it seems like everything is going to the right place. Any help would be appreciated.
